Output 24ca636f840e69ec7058d2932dfb01312372c8502233caeb06c848f4d5cdd99e:1

value
3572916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 508a23ebec712e4f0afa1a607ca635d62afe132c OP_EQUAL
address
392sU3j2zVwqYm34kydbwTuPCiCpxZsSro
transaction
24ca636f840e69ec7058d2932dfb01312372c8502233caeb06c848f4d5cdd99e
spent
true